是否可以使用css使第二行齐平?

时间:2014-02-01 16:37:19

标签: jquery css

我正在为垂直列中的css菜单设置样式。如果菜单项不适合,我希望过度运行是正确的。

|                    |
| o Item             |
| o Item             |
| o Longer link that |
|         doesn't fit|
|                    |

我尝试使用伪选择器第一行:

<style>
p {
   text-align:right;
   background-color:pink;
   }

p:first-line
   {
   text-align:left;
   background-color:yellow;
   }
</style>

但忽略text-align的第一行新值,同时接受背景颜色。

答:这可能在CSS中吗? B:如果没有,你能建议一个简单的非CSS工作吗?

1 个答案:

答案 0 :(得分:0)

text-align属性不能与:first-line伪选择器

一起使用

允许的属性为

  1. 字体属性
  2. color property
  3. 背景属性
  4. “字间距”
  5. “字母间距”
  6. “文字修饰”
  7. “垂直对齐”
  8. “文本变换” 9.'line高度”
  9. here

    上查看

    更好的方法是使用span标记包装文本,然后应用样式。